Hello there simplicity


From as far back as the 1960s much emphasis was positioned on bold colour in the shower room. Formed wall ceramic tiles of nautical animals and also outrageous colours were the trend, together with plastic. Plastic washroom décor was the trend, from vibrant orange, olive green, mustard yellow as well as chocolate brownish coloured tooth brush, soap as well as towel owners, to thick patterned plastic shower curtains that yelled colours of the boldest nature.
As the moments went on, the 1970s and also early 1980s became a duration when gold shower room fixings and also furnishing, such as taps, towel rails and also toilet roll holders, were considered extremely elegant. These over the top gold cut features were all the rage, and restroom design was 'loud'. Included in this were those as soon as wonderful shower room collections in colours avocado, reefs pink, and also delicious chocolate brown. Bathroom colour has changed substantially over the past years, and tones have actually ended up being a lot more neutral, often with a tip of colour that includes a corresponding vigour to the total plan.
Of the many numerous individuals that participated in Plumbworld's recent restroom survey, an overwhelming 82 per cent said they "hated" the as soon as pietistic avocado and also reefs pink shower room collections, colours residue of 1970s and 1980s, which are typically qualified as being dark and also plain.
According to the study, chrome shower room taps were much chosen to gold.
So, when designing and enhancing your washroom keep those dark colours at bay, consider white collections, and also select chrome mendings as well as furnishings as opposed to showy gold.

Shower power


When planning the layout of your shower room, among the most important facets to think about is placing a shower. Some shower rooms don't have ample area to consist of a shower cubicle, so assess your alternatives. Consider installing a shower over the bath if space is restricted.
The survey showed that 94 percent of its individuals believed that a shower in a bathroom was really crucial, and also 81 percent said they favored a different shower enclosure in a huge restroom. Almost 65 percent said their perfect would be a power shower, while 27 percent liked mixer showers, and just 12 per cent selected electric showers.
If you have picked a shower over the bath, after that think about putting a set glass screen instead of a shower drape. It might cost a couple of extra pounds, however majority of the survey's factors preferred a fixed glass screen to a shower curtain.

Selecting your tub


Contrary to typical idea, adding a whirlpool bath to boost residential or commercial property value does not always work. So if you're considering marketing your building, attempt to avoid buying a whirlpool bath in the hopes of obtaining additional revenue.
The study revealed that close to 53 per cent of its individuals were not phased by them, while just a little 38 percent of individuals "liked" them. Surprisingly, 62 per cent said they had "no solid sight" towards corner bathrooms either, which indicates the standard rectangle-shaped baths still hold clout against their fixed up counter parts.

Shower room floor covering


Attempt to prevent need to put rugs on the shower room flooring, according to the survey it is not too favoured. The study revealed that the recommended flooring covering was floor tiles, with 75 percent claiming they "enjoyed" a tiled washroom floor. Popular vinyl floor covering has not yet shed its place in the washroom, with greater than 61 per cent claiming they really did not have any solid likes or disapproval in the direction of it.
When picking your washroom flooring, ceramic tiles is the favoured choice, however if the budget plan is limited, after that plastic floor covering will not let you down.
Apart from the flooring, make sure your windows look appealing. When it concerns dressing your restroom windows, avoid those restroom nets and textile drapes. The study revealed that 94 percent stated they favoured blinds in the shower room to curtains.

7 Smart Strategies for Bathroom Remodeling


You dream about a bathroom that’s high on comfort and personal style, but you also want materials, fixtures, and amenities with lasting value. Wake up! You can have both.



A midrange bathroom remodel is a solid investment, according to the “Remodeling Impact Report” from the NATIONAL ASSOCIATION OF REALTORS®. A bath remodel with a national median cost of 30,000 will recover about 50% of those costs when it’s time to sell your home.



Regardless of payback potential, you’ll probably be glad you went ahead and updated your bathroom. Homeowners polled for the report gave their bathroom renovation a Joy Score of 9.6 — a rating based on those who said they were happy or satisfied with their project, with 10 being the highest rating and 1 the lowest.


Stick to a Plan


A bathroom remodel is no place for improvisation. Before ripping out the first tile, think hard about how you will use the space, what materials and fixtures you want, and how much you’re willing to spend.



The National Kitchen and Bath Association recommends spending up to six months evaluating and planning before beginning work. That way, you have a roadmap that will guide decisions, even the ones made under remodeling stress. Once work has begun — a process that averages two to three months — resist changing your mind. Work stoppages and alterations add costs. Some contractors include clauses in their contracts that specify premium prices for changing original plans.



If planning isn’t your strong suit, hire a designer. In addition to adding style and efficiency, a professional designer makes sure contractors and installers are scheduled in an orderly fashion. Hiring a bathroom designer costs 50 to 200 per hour for a consultation, and 1,200 to 4,800 (5% to 10% of the project) for a complete design.


Keep the Same Footprint


You can afford that Italian tile you love if you can live with the total square footage you already have.



Keeping the same footprint, and locating new plumbing fixtures near existing plumbing pipes, saves demolition and reconstruction dollars. You’ll also cut down on the dust and debris that make remodeling so hard to live with.



Make the most of the space you have. Glass doors on showers and tubs open up the area. A pedestal sink takes up less room than a vanity. If you miss the storage, replace a mirror with a deep medicine cabinet.


Make Lighting a Priority


Multiple shower heads and radiant heat floors are fabulous adds to a bathroom remodel. But few items make a bathroom more satisfying than lighting designed for everyday grooming. You can install lighting for a fraction of the cost of pricier amenities.



Well-designed bathroom task lighting surrounds vanity mirrors and eliminates shadows on faces: You look better already. The scheme includes two ceiling- or soffit-mounted fixtures, and side fixtures or sconces distributed vertically across 24 inches (to account for people of various heights). Four-bulb lighting fixtures work well for side lighting.



Today, shopping for bulbs means paying attention to lumens, the amount of light you get from a bulb — i.e., brightness. For these bathroom task areas, the Lighting Research Center recommends:


  • Toilet: 45 lumens


  • Sink: 450 lumens


  • Vanity: 1,680 lumens


  • Clear the Air


    Bathroom ventilation systems may be out of sight, but they shouldn’t be out of mind during a bathroom remodel.



    Bathroom ventilation is essential for removing excess humidity that fogs mirrors, makes bathroom floors slippery, and contributes to the growth of mildew and mold. Controlling mold and humidity is especially important for maintaining healthy indoor air quality and protecting the value of your home — mold remediation is expensive, and excess humidity can damage cabinets and painted finishes.



    A bathroom vent and water closet fan should exhaust air to the outside — not simply to the space between ceiling joists. Better models have whisper-quiet exhaust fans and humidity-controlled switches that activate when a sensor detects excess moisture in the air.



    Think Storage


    Bathroom storage is a challenge: By the time you’ve installed the toilet, shower, and sink, there’s often little space left to store towels, toilet paper, and hair and body products. Here are some ways to find storage in hidden places.


  • Think vertically: Upper wall space in a bathroom is often underused. Freestanding, multi-tiered shelf units designed to fit over toilet tanks turn unused wall area into found storage. Spaces between wall studs create attractive and useful niches for holding soaps and toiletries. Install shelves over towel bars to use blank wall space.


  • Think movable: Inexpensive woven baskets set on the floor are stylish towel holders. A floor-stand coat rack holds wet towels, bath robes, and clothes.


  • Think utility: Adding a slide-out tray to vanity cabinet compartments provides full access to stored items and prevents lesser-used items from being lost or forgotten.

  • Contribute Sweat Equity


    Shave labor costs by doing some work yourself. Tell your contractor which projects you’ll handle, so there are no misunderstandings later.


  • Install window and baseboard trim; save 250.


  • Paint walls and trim, 200 square feet; save 200.


  • Install toilet; save 150.


  • Install towel bars and shelves; save 20 each.


  • Choose Low-Cost Design for High Visual Impact


    A “soft scheme” adds visual zest to your bathroom, but doesn’t create a one-of-a-kind look that might scare away future buyers.



    Soft schemes employ neutral colors for permanent fixtures and surfaces, then add pizzazz with items that are easily changed, such as shower curtains, window treatments, towels, throw rugs, and wall colors. These relatively low-cost decorative touches provide tons of personality but are easy to redo whenever you want.
